Indoor Presentation Description:

This talk introduces the practice and principles of Forest Bathing and invites participants to reflect on how we understand self-care and wellness. Together, we will explore what it means to move beyond seeing nature as a backdrop for relaxation and instead recognize it as a living companion and teacher in our pursuit of well-being. We will discuss how nature connection supports emotional regulation, nervous-system balance, and a deeper sense of belonging. You will leave with a new understanding of how nature and wellbeing are connected.

This conversation sets the stage for the following Forest Bathing walk. It will provide the theoretical framework of Forest Bathing to help us ground into the practice.

Forest Bathing Walk Description:

Organized by Downsview Park in partnership with Forest Bathing Club (FBC), this walk is offered to the public as an introductory experience to the practice of Forest Bathing. Led by Emily Pleasance, this experience will offer you a space to drop into your body, tune into your senses, and connect with the more-than-human-world. You will be introduced to the concept of all beings, have stories told about the land, and be showed alternative ways of being with yourself, each other, and nature. Unlike a hike where there is a destination, this practice is about arriving here, in the present moment.

How Forest Bathing Works:

•No prior experience is necessary

•Slow and relaxed walk with time to rest

•Approximately 1.5hrs (route no longer than 1km)

•Invitations offering you to be with nature

 How To Prepare for Forest Bathing: 

•Wear layered clothing and dress for -10 degrees cooler than the forecast. This is not a brisk walk so we will not be creating body heat to support us. Choose clothing that offers a lot of warmth with the knowing that you can always take off layers to cool down. 

•Bring weather-appropriate and comfortable clothing, a water bottle, and an open mind. 

Bio: Emily Pleasance, MA, RP (Q), ExAT 

Emily is an artist, climate-aware Registered Psychotherapist (Qualifying), Expressive Arts Therapist (ExAT), and certified Nature & Forest Therapy Guide. She is the founder of the Forest Bathing Club and the Ontario Regional Co-Coordinator for the Climate Psychology Alliance of North America. Emily’s work in eco/climate psychology bridges public programs, corporate wellness, and clinical practice, supporting individuals and groups in navigating stress, anxiety, and climate grief through arts, body, and nature-based approaches. Fundamentally, her practice is focused on human–nature relationships.
